Serif Contrasted Abpy 7 is a light, narrow, very high cont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

A refined serif with dramatic thick–thin modulation and a distinctly vertical stress. Hairline serifs and terminals stay crisp and unbracketed, while primary stems carry most of the weight, creating a sharp, polished rhythm. Curves are smooth and taut, with generous counters and a measured, slightly condensed presence; joins and crossbars are kept light, giving the design an airy, high-end finish.

Best suited to display typography such as magazine headlines, decks, pull quotes, and title treatments where its contrast and hairlines can print cleanly. It also fits luxury branding, cosmetics, jewelry, and high-end packaging when used at generous sizes with ample spacing. For extended reading, it will perform most comfortably in larger text sizes and well-controlled production environments.

The tone is sophisticated and formal, with the kind of poised glamour associated with luxury and cultural publishing. Its stark contrast and razor-fine details convey precision, exclusivity, and a quiet dramatic flair, reading as modern-classic rather than rustic or casual.

The design appears intended to deliver a contemporary take on classic high-contrast serif letterforms, prioritizing elegance, verticality, and crisp detail. Its structure balances traditional proportions with a sleek, editorial sensibility geared toward impactful titles and premium brand expression.

Uppercase forms feel stately and display-oriented, with strong verticals and restrained ornamentation; the Q’s tail is a subtle signature detail. In the sample text, word shapes remain clear, but the finest strokes and serifs become visually fragile at smaller sizes or on low-contrast backgrounds, suggesting careful typesetting and output conditions.
